I'm browsing some old board reports on the mailing list and stumbled
upon this one here. What we have right now in svn trunk is this:

   * Suited for:
   *  - MSI K8N Neo4: NVIDIA CK804

   [...]

   {0x10DE, 0x005E, 0x1462, 0x7125,  0x10DE, 0x0052, 0x1462, 0x7125, NULL,
   NULL,         NULL,          "MSI",         "K8N Neo4-F",            0,
   OK, nvidia_mcp_gpio2_raise},


I.e., the comment talks about "MSI K8N Neo4" while the name in the
board-enable is "MSI K8N Neo4-F" (note the added -F). However, in

  http://www.flashrom.org/pipermail/flashrom/2009-November/000889.html

the user reported that the board is a "K8N Neo4 Platinum (PCB 1.0)" from

  http://www.msi.com/index.php?func=proddesc&maincat_no=1&prod_no=165

On the MSI page, searching for "neo4" I can see:

  K8N Neo4 Platinum (PCB 1.0)
  K8N Neo4 Platinum (PCB 3.0)
  K8N Neo4-F (PCB 1.0)
  K8N Neo4-F (PCB 3.0)
  K8N Neo4-FI (PCB 1.0)
  K8N Neo4-FX (PCB 1.0)

So there are two Neo4-F versions (probably differing hardware) and two
Neo4-F versions (also potentially differing hardware). I cannot spot any
pure "Neo4" board without any suffix on the current website.

Fraser, could you please use the latest flashrom from svn and send us
the following info:

 * flashrom -V
 * lspci -nnvvvxxx
 * superiotool -deV

Also, can you confirm that the board you have is indeed "K8N Neo4
Platinum (PCB 1.0)"? It's probably best to check what is actually
printed on the board itself, I wouldn't entirely trust dmidecode or
similar tools.

We should fix the board name in the code in one direction or the other.
It would also be nice to get a report of whether the current
board-enable for the mainboard works (this requires a write or erase
test), I think we never got a report, so we should probably mark the
board-enable as untested for now.
